Spiritual leader and global peace ambassador Sri Sri Ravi Shankar was received by Iceland’s Prime Minister H.E. Bjarni Benediktsson in Reykjavík on June 24. The leaders attended a bilateral meeting to discuss the need and importance of “mental health as the basis for individual and societal welfare.”
According to a press note, their meeting focused on the current peace situation in Europe, the need to address mental health issues, and the importance of putting individual well-being at the core of societal prosperity.
“Gurudev shared about the work of the Art of Living Foundation which uses time-tested meditation and breathing techniques to help individuals get rid of stress, tension, and anxiety, and which facilitates overall physical and mental well-being,” the note read.

It added that the Art of Living founder also spoke about how the foundation helps rehabilitate prisoners and gang members in Denmark with their ‘Breathe Smart’ program — which aims “to reduce the cycle of violence and drug addiction among offenders, and promote inner peace and a sense of care for one another.”
As part of the meeting, Sri Sri Ravi Shankar also commended PM Benediktsson for Iceland’s contribution to climate change, noting that almost 100% of their electricity production comes from renewable sources.
The leader’s Iceland visit follows meetings and keynote speeches at events at the United Nations in Geneva. He will now we traveling to the United States to attended public events.
